I have a Dell Dimension 8250 with Windows XP. Connected to it is an Epson Stylus C62 & a Dell A10 PrinterA920. Until 7 hours ago both worked perfectly. Now both will print in colour but not in black.The Dell has a new ink cartridge & the Epsom's is half full. I've cleaned them, reinstalled the drivers, gone through all the trouble shooter helps I could find,restored it back to 1st February, run systems checks and don't know what to do next.
Many thanks for any help. Heather.

Make sure you took the plastic tape off the print head. The ink is probably
dry, try soaking the ink head in about 1/4 inch of warm water for about 15
min, and try again. Might shake the ink cart down like a thermometer and see
if you can get any ink to come out the part that rides on the paper. (the
head).
